## Idempotency Keys for Payment Retries (Lumopay)

Every retry of a charge request must reuse the original idempotency key; generating a new key on retry can produce duplicate charges. Keys are scoped per merchant and expire after 48 hours. Reviewers should verify keys are derived server-side, never from client input. The full key-generation specification and threat model are maintained on the internal page.

dashboard of kaguf-tawip = https://vault.merlaqsys.test/issue

Changelog — Quarryline build migration, week 12. Heads up, new folks: as part of moving QuarryCI onto the hermetic Bastline build system, we renamed BUILD_CACHE_TOKEN to HERMETIC_CACHE_KEY. Old name still works until next sprint, then it's gone. Update any local env files you copied from the wiki — the template in the repo is already current. When you set up your sandbox, your env file needs one addition right after the renamed cache line: the secret itself.

env line for fafof-fahag: LEDGER_TOKEN5=f8790

Subject: Morvane Licensing Dispute — Status

Team,

Quick update for sales leads. Morvane Systems continues to contest our right to bundle the Calyx module with Fernhold deployments. Their counsel sent a revised claim last week; ours believes it overreaches but expects months of back-and-forth. Until resolved, do not quote Calyx bundles to new prospects without legal review. Existing contracts are unaffected. Keep messaging neutral if customers ask. Our fallback position, should talks collapse, is summarised below.

internal memo for hahif-yafof: Headcount on the Quenwyn team goes from 7 to 120 by the end of October. Gross margin on Quenwyn came in at 15 percent against a plan of 10 percent.

## Changelog — Flagwright 2.4.0

Renamed `ROLLOUT_KEY` to `FLAGWRIGHT_ROLLOUT_KEY` to avoid collisions with sidecar configs. Old name is deprecated; it stops working in 3.0. Migration: update env files in all deploy targets, then restart the evaluator. No behavior change otherwise. Percentage ramps and kill switches are unaffected. After renaming, the evaluator still requires its control-plane credential, set on the line that follows:

vault entry, yahif-yajep: COURIER_KEY29=b802bdf8034096b65a51c6ba5abe2